# Secrets Rotation Utility — Contacts

The Keywarden rotation utility is owned by the platform security pod at Ostermill. Routine rotation failures should first be checked against the run ledger, as most are transient lease expiries. Schema or policy changes require review by the pod lead before merge. For ownership questions, audit requests, or emergency rotation support, future maintainers should write to the pod's shared inbox.

escalation mailbox, yajeg-bageg: quenax.olidor@lumiccorp.internal

Ticket: Config drift in Quillrank relevance tuning. The boost weights on prod no longer match the tuning notes from the last relevance review — someone hot-patched synonym decay and never committed it. Recall on long-tail queries dropped 4%. Revert prod to the reviewed baseline before touching anything else. The approved baseline values are these:

config for bahop-fajep:
DRUATH_PIN=4501
DRUATH_TENANT=briwyn
DRUATH_METRICS_HOST=metrics.druath.brasksoft.test
DRUATH_SEAL=seal_7d2e069d
DRUATH_STANDBY_TEAM=olieth

- [ ] **Garage occupancy feed (Northgate deck):** Verify the `stall-count` publisher reconciles sensor totals against the gate tally every 15 minutes, and that stale readings older than two cycles are flagged rather than silently carried forward. Confirm the reconciliation threshold matches the documented 2% tolerance. Sign-off on this item must come from the accountable engineer named below.

named custodian: Brivan Eliath Quenox Frador

Heads up from the Ops team at Branmore Systems: after-hours server room access isn't on the standard badge profile, so if someone turns up at the facilities desk past 19:00 asking to get into B-14, that's normal. Check they're on the on-call rota printout first — no rota, no entry, no exceptions. Log the time in and out in the red binder. Once verified, let them through the inner door using the code below.

staff pass of kawip-hawef = bdg-QLP-2